If you are working with a small space, put up several mirrors. Mirrors increase the depth of a room, which can add value. Investing in an interesting, attractive mirror can really add to your design project.
Before you start designing your space, make a decision on what type of mood you want the room to have. You can make add any mood to your room, whether it be exciting or serene. Choosing the mood of the room will help you choose more cohesive decorations in order to create a better room.
Eliminate clutter and over-sized furniture from small rooms. Try to find a few nice storage containers to keep any clutter organized. Boxes can be used to store toys, and a new filing cabinet may be in order if you have lots of paperwork. This can be placed in the corner and improves the overall appearance of the room.
To add a fresh look to a room, you can get a coffee table that is original. Rather than simply using a regular table, think about putting a chest in the room or some other piece that makes sense. Shop around at different stores to find some ideas on some old items you can use for your coffee table.
Don't forget the little things. Small things can sometimes have a big impact. Instead of making a large change, such as a new floor, replace all the fixtures in a room and coordinate them with the room's decor.

Design your rooms with your own style in mind. While it is nice if others enjoy your space, you have to live with your decisions. Perhaps you have a nautical bent, or prefer something a bit more Victorian; either way, go with what you like. You may not like it further down the road, which means you can always redesign it then.
Place storage boxes in playrooms, keeping your kid's height in mind. This way, your child will be able to participate when it comes time to clean and organize his toys. Your room will look cleaner and you will be able to move around better in the space.
Be aware that there's a risk of cluttering up a room with excess furnishings when you get into an ambitious interior design job. Sometimes less really is more. Cramming your room full of furniture and accessories can make the room feel small. A wiser move is to opt for one or two key furnishings with clean lines; these free up additional space.
